The experiment on effect of organic amendments and growth
promoters on morphology and yield of Gymnema sylvestre
was laid out in split plot design with three replications.
The main plot consisted of different combinations of basal
application of organic amendments and the sub plots consist
of the foliar spray of biostimulants such as, humic acid,
panchagavya and Manchurian mushroom. The results revealed
that the treatment combination, M1S4
that is, FYM (25 t/ha) + recommended dose of fertilizer
(90:45:35 kg/ha of NPK/ha) combined with foliar spraying of
panchagavya and Manchurian mushroom extract each at 3% and
humic acid at 0.3%, recorded highest plant height (227.53,
286.47, 300.1 and 334.54 cm), number of leaves (62.0, 70.0,
82.0 and 95.0) number of branches (36.048.055.058.0), leaf
area (12.60, 15.52, 17.50 and 18.92 cm2), fresh
biomass (2.55, 3.22, 3.88 and 4.10 kg/plant) and dry biomass
(0.638, 0.782, 0.890 and 0.913 kg/plant) at 180, 240, 300
and 360 days after transplanting, respectively. Regarding
the quality parameters, the treatment combination, M6S4
(FYM (25 t/ha) + Vermicompost (5 t/ha) + Neem cake-250
kg) combined with foliar spraying of panchagavya and
Manchurian mushroom extract each at 3% and humic acid at
0.3%, registered the highest crude gymnemic acid content of
485.74 mg 100 g-1 dry weight.
